Isachsen, Ellef Ringnes Island, Nunavut vs Pimentel Climate & Distance Between

Dominican Republic flag
  • The distance between Isachsen, Ellef Ringnes Island, Nunavut, Canada and Pimentel, Dominican Republic is approximately 6,851 km or 4,257 mi.
  • To reach Isachsen, Ellef Ringnes Island, Nunavut in this distance one would set out from Pimentel bearing 353°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Isachsen, Ellef Ringnes Island, Nunavut bearing 323.7° or NW .
  • Isachsen, Ellef Ringnes Island, Nunavut has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Pimentel has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
  • Isachsen, Ellef Ringnes Island, Nunavut is in or near the polar desert biome whereas Pimentel is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 45.5 °C (81.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 34.6 °C (62.3°F) more in Isachsen, Ellef Ringnes Island, Nunavut.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1708.8 mm (67.3 in) less which is equivalent to 1708.8 l/m² (41.94 US gal/ft²) or 17,088,000 l/ha (1,826,821 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 58.3° lower in Isachsen, Ellef Ringnes Island, Nunavut than in Pimentel.
